Grasping the Essentials of Massage Therapy
Even though numerous people associate massage therapy with relaxation, it contains a array of techniques aimed at bettering physical and mental well-being. At its core, massage therapy involves the manipulation of soft tissues in the body, like muscles, tendons, and ligaments. Multiple styles exist, each designed to address particular needs. For example, Swedish massage emphasizes relaxation through light strokes, while sports massage targets athletes' unique concerns, boosting both performance and recovery.
The practice roots trace back to ancient civilizations, highlighting its enduring importance in healthcare. Techniques may include kneading, tapping, and stretching, which can promote circulation and relieve tension. Additionally, the therapeutic environment, often featuring soothing music and dim lighting, enriches the complete experience. Recognizing these basics permits individuals to value how massage therapy can act as a valuable tool for achieving better health and well-being, beyond just relaxation.

Minimizes Persistent Pain
Long-term pain can substantially influence one's life quality, making efficient pain management vital. Deep tissue massage has proven to be a beneficial alternative for those enduring chronic pain. By applying firm pressure to the deeper layers of muscle and connective tissue, this technique targets specific pain points and muscle tension. Research demonstrates that deep tissue massage can minimize inflammation, increase blood circulation, and trigger endorphin production, nature's pain management system. Additionally, the method can help break down scar tissue and adhesions, both of which contribute to chronic pain. People frequently experience a substantial reduction in pain intensity following consistent treatments, emphasizing deep tissue massage's effectiveness as a therapeutic method for chronic pain management.

Uncovering Swedish Massage for Relaxation
While many massage modalities exist, Swedish massage stands out for its power to facilitate deep relaxation. Defined by lengthy, flowing strokes and gentle kneading, this approach helps the body to de-stress while elevating the overall sense of health. The integration of practices such as effleurage, petrissage, and friction allows for a complete approach to relaxation, targeting both physical and mental tension.
Swedish massage is particularly beneficial for individuals seeking stress relief and emotional balance. The soothing motions improve blood movement and lymph drainage, supporting toxin discharge and cultivating a sensation of tranquility. Moreover, the relaxing essence of this therapy can aid in diminishing stress and bettering rest quality. As a widely-chosen service in spas and wellness establishments, Swedish massage stays a top pick for people wanting to leave behind daily demands and experience a state of calm and revitalization.
The Transformative Power of Sports Massage
A lot of athletes and active persons seek out sports massage for its specific benefits in injury avoidance and healing. This specialized form of massage therapy concentrates on specific muscle groups, enhancing flexibility and reducing soreness. By utilizing techniques such as deep tissue manipulation and stretching, sports massage aids in reduce tension and improve circulation, which can expedite the healing process after demanding physical activity.
Additionally, it supports the identification of potential problem areas, allowing practitioners to address issues before they escalate into more serious injuries. Regular sessions can enhance performance by promoting muscle relaxation and increasing range of motion. In addition, sports massage can decrease recovery time by flushing out metabolic waste and delivering essential nutrients to fatigued muscles. Better Circulation Effects
The use of heated stones in massage therapy not only promotes relaxation but also greatly enhances circulation. Warmth radiating from the stones permeates deep muscle layers, dilating vessels and increasing blood flow. The improved circulation assists in supplying crucial nutrients and oxygen to tissues, enabling metabolic waste removal. With improved blood flow in the body, inflammation may decrease while overall well-being increases. Additionally, the calming warmth promotes bodily relaxation, potentially decreasing heart rate and lowering blood pressure. Through incorporating heated stones into massage treatments, practitioners can offer clients a comprehensive method for improving circulation while concurrently fostering profound relaxation and comfort.

The Distinctive Benefits of Aromatherapy Massage
Even though various forms of massage therapy deliver relaxation and stress relief, aromatherapy massage uniquely combines these positive effects with the therapeutic attributes of essential oils. This technique not only relieves physical tension but also stimulates the senses, elevating the overall experience. Each essential oil contains specific characteristics; for example, lavender is known for its calming qualities, while eucalyptus can invigorate and refresh.
The synergy of massage techniques and aromatic oils encourages emotional well-being, often resulting in reduced anxiety and improved mood. Furthermore, the inhalation of essential oils can stimulate the limbic system, which is accountable for emotions and memories, offering a holistic approach to healing.
In addition, aromatherapy massage can increase physical benefits such as increased circulation and pain relief, making it an compelling choice for those seeking both mental and physical rejuvenation. In the end, this therapy provides a multi-faceted approach to health, addressing simultaneously body and mind.

How Frequently Should I Receive a Massage for Best Results?
For best outcomes, those seeking massage therapy should target massages every two to four weeks, according to their specific needs and lifestyle. Maintaining regularity improves tension relief, muscular healing, and general wellness, supporting sustained health gains.
Could Massage Therapy Aid In Managing Specific Medical Conditions?
Massage treatment may assist in reducing symptoms of various medical conditions, such as chronic pain, anxiety, and muscle tension. Various techniques can be tailored to accommodate individual health concerns, promoting overall wellness and relaxation.
Can You Safely Get Massage Therapy While Pregnant?
Massage therapy is usually deemed safe during pregnancy, given that it is performed by a trained practitioner trained in prenatal techniques. It can alleviate discomfort, lower stress, and encourage relaxation, helping both mother and baby.
What's the Appropriate Attire for a Massage Session?
For massage appointments, individuals commonly wear comfortable, loose-fitting clothes. Some prefer to undress to their level of comfort, while therapists provide draping for privacy. It's important to prioritize comfort and ease of movement during the session.
